WebRanjan Vepa, in Engineered Biomimicry, 2013. 4.1 Introduction to biomimicry. Biomimicry refers to the process of mimicking living plants and animals in the way in which they solve problems or tackle tasks confronting them. Thus, biomimicry aims to imitate biological processes or systems. Research into biomimetic robotics is currently being conducted …
